AS Business Studies To get a good grade in the AS Business studies, you need a good understanding of the subject matter, an up to date awareness of current business issues, good communication skills and good exam technique.

The Edexcel AS level Business exam consists of two papers/units

Unit 1: Developing New Business Ideas. (examiner is Jim Byng)
This is an introduction to business and business ideas. Usually based on material you have been covering in your ‘homework exams’.
Content summary:
This unit covers the characteristics students would need to develop to be successful in business and how new or existing businesses generate their product or service ideas and test them through market research. Students should also consider the competition in the market; the economic climate; how the business might be financed and how much revenue the idea might generate.
Assessment:
Section A: supported multiple‐choice questions, where students write a short justification of why they chose that answer and/or why the other answers are incorrect, worth 32 marks out of 70 marks (8 multiple choice questions).
Section B: questions based on ‘data’, worth 38 marks out of total of 70 marks.
Note: This unit is based on your basic knowledge. Homework questions help improve your basic knowledge for this exam.
